Q: What can I cook with the CeraPro Electric Cooker?

The CeraPro Electric Cooker is a multi-purpose, cooking appliance. You can boil, stew, saute, sear, fry and reheat in this one, easy to use pot. Plus, with the BONUS Multi-Use Steamer Tray you can steam your food too.

Q: How big is CeraPro Electric Cooker?

The CeraPro Electric Cooker is available in two sizes:

  • 1.5L CeraPro Electric Cooker: 36 cm (D) × 20.5 cm (W) × 9 cm (H) - capacity serves 1-3
  • 2.5L CeraPro Electric Cooker^: 36 cm (D) × 20.5 cm (W) × 11 cm (H) - capacity serves 3-5

^Available at an additional cost.

Q: Is CeraPro Electric Cooker rechargeable?

No. The CeraPro Electric Cooker requires a continuous power source and can be plugged into your standard Australian Power Outlet.

Q: Can the CeraPro Electric Cooker be used on stovetops or in an oven?

No. The CeraPro Electric Cooker is an electrical appliance and should never be used on a stovetop, or in an oven, or exposed to any heating or cooking element. To use the CeraPro Electric Cooker, simply plug it into any power point, select your heat setting, and you’re ready to cook in under a minute.

Always read and follow full instructions for use.

Q: Is the CeraPro Electric Cooker metal utensil safe?

No. Using metal utensils could damage the non-stick ceramic cooking surface
